Tanning Industry (State) Award

 

INDUSTRIAL RELATIONS COMMISSION OF NEW SOUTH WALES

 

Application by Liquor, Hospitality and Miscellaneous Union, New South Wales Branch, Industrial Organisation of Employees.

 

(No. IRC 979 of 2007)

 

Before Commissioner Ritchie

25 June 2007

 

VARIATION

 

1.          Delete paragraph (iii) (b), of clause 4, Wages of the award, published 8 February 2002 (331 I.G. 157), and insert in lieu thereof the following:-

 

(b)        The rates of pay in this award include the adjustments payable under the State Wage Case of June 2007.  These adjustments may be offset against:

 

(1)        any equivalent over award payments, and/or

 

(2)        award wage increases since 29 May 1991 other than safety net, State Wage Case and minimum rates adjustments.
